Stefanos is a Candidate for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ering at the Georgia Institute of Technology, who is passionate about the intersection between creative mechanical design, robotics and human-centered design; in pursuit of this unique intersection, his vision is to design and deploy robots for social impact


As a Workshop Lead and Teaching Assistant at the Innovation & Design Collaborative, the Senior Executive Officer at OpenIDEO Atlanta Chapter at Georgia Tech and a Mechanical Design Engineer at an ocean-cleaning project, Stefanos has gained a diverse range of experiences that align with his vision


He has studied abroad twice at Georgia Tech Lorraine in France, and interned at Technical University of Munich in Germany. Through his time in Europe, he came to realize the limited applications of emerging technologies for social impact. Through his leadership role at OpenIDEO Atlanta Chapter at Georgia Tech, he aspires to spread the mindset of design thinking and inspire more engineers, computer scientists and mathematicians to pursue social ventures instead of for-profit start-ups in the field of robotics


His hobbies include animation, photography, soccer and bicycle riding, but he is always keen in exploring new hobbies along the way!
